Hi, Binky. Welcome to A2K. I make it the easy way:

Cut your steak in long strips and flour lightly then brown.

Add golden mushroom soup and allow steak to cook thoroughly.

boil egg noodles, but don't overcook.

Right before serving, add the drained noodles and sour cream.

Quick and easy and delicious.

We cook it a bit different: You'll need for 2 servings

Beef filet (1 - 1.5 lb)
2 sp Butter (sweet)
salt, pepper
2 onions
2 tomatoes, skin removed
1/4 cup sour cream or better creme fraiche
1 teasp. mustard, lemon juice
1 cup mushrooms
2 large pickles
if you like: 1/4 lb. cooked ham

Cut beef in stripes and sautè in hot butter for a couple
of minutes . Take the beef out, salt and pepper it and
keep it warm. Put diced onions in the pan, add tomatoes
and cook until onions are soft. Add sour cream or
creme fraiche, mustard and lemon juice.

Cook mushrooms in hot butter for 5 minutes, ad diced
pickles and add it to the onions with sour cream. Add
the beef and cook for an additional 5 minutes.

You can add cut up cooked ham, if you choose to (I don't)

Serve with pasta, or potatoes.

Red bees, cornichons (all sliced in small pieces) and some tarragon, if you want it tasty like the "original" bœuf Stroganoff.

Instead of onions use shallots, and you need about about two cups of good beef stock for the sauce as well.
